    The Office of Geospatial Information (OGI) is seeking to fill our GIS Manager position. This position is responsible for the development, implementation, and management of GIS development teams, software, and strategies. It requires someone who can help us communicate the vision of expanding the use of geospatial technology across 15 agencies. You will support a dedicated group of GIS users within the State of Missouri and you will manage a team of 18 who work together to support the GIS infrastructure, provide end-user support for GIS software, and develop and maintain GIS applications and the underlying databases.

    This position is within the Office of Administration Information Technology Services Division (OA-ITSD), Office of Geospatial Information (OGI).

    • Work closely with the GIS Team Supervisors and other team members to evaluate and plan organizational GIS needs.
    • Oversee the operation and maintenance of the GIS platform, including software updates, data storage, and application development.
    • Build relationships with different agency leaders and stakeholders, identifying their geographic needs and recommending ways to integrate location into their business workflows.
    • Assist agency leadership in developing geospatial strategies and policies.
    • Provide expertise on geospatial issues and advise decision-makers on policy matters related to geographic information.
    • Establish and implement standards and policies for managing our ArcOnline and Portal environments.
    • Coordinate the dissemination of the State’s geospatial data with stakeholders and Missouri's GIS clearinghouse.
    • Assist the Chief Information Officer (CIO) with strategic planning and direction.
    • Participate in fiscal and contract-related activities associated with geospatial infrastructure.
    • Represent the State of Missouri in state, regional, and national GIS activities.
    • Participate in other GIS activities as assigned.


    • Bachelor's degree in GIS, Computer Science, Geography, Environmental Science/Geology, or a closely related field with a strong GIS/IT emphasis.
    • Comprehensive knowledge and experience with ESRI ArcGIS platform, including ArcGIS Pro, ArcGIS Online, and ArcGIS Enterprise.
    • Comprehensive knowledge of spatial data analysis, map design, and data management.
    • Working knowledge of geodatabases, and database design.
    • Skills in designing, overseeing, and managing projects.
    • Ability to convey technical information and concepts to non-technical staff and stakeholders.
    • Ability to organize and manage multiple tasks and/or projects at the same time.
    • Ability to define a problem, analyze relevant information, and develop solutions and plans to solve the problem.
    • Experienced Supervisor and team-builder who has a history of cultivating a positive and professional work environment.
    • Ability to develop and sustain cooperative working relationships.
    •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written, with technical experts, clients, vendors, and staff.
    • Ability to be self-motivated, exercise independent judgment, and act with limited existing guidelines to follow.
    • Ability to learn and adapt to changing GIS technologies and capabilities.
